The Course Pointing Device (CPD) provides a 2-axis pointing capability for external payloads to achieve a pointing accuracy in the order of 1° to compensate for Station orbital motions and seasonal Sun apparent motion.

OBS

... three instruments [:] SOVIM: solar variable and irradiance monitor [;] SOLSPEC: solar spectral irradiance measurements [;] SOLACES: auto-calibrating Extreme Ultraviolet and Ultraviolet spectrometers ... will be mounted on the ESA-developed Course Pointing Device (CPD) with a pointing accuracy of the order of 1° to compensate for ISS motions. The fourth instrument, the Sky Polarisation Observatory, will be accommodated separately.
